Enrollment specialist Paulette Lopez has been working in the student accounts department at CSU since September 2024. She enjoys helping students understand the financial aspects of their enrollment and successfully register for their programs. In addition to her role at CSU, Paulette is seeking a bachelor’s degree in business administration.
We asked Paulette to share more about her role at CSU and what she loves most about her career:
- Can you describe your role at CSU? I am an enrollment specialist in the student accounts department. I assist students with the financial side of their enrollment. Students call us when they have questions about outgoing funds, incoming funds, refunds, receipts, etc. We tend to do a lot!
- What do you enjoy most about your job? I know it sounds cliché, but the people are genuinely the best part of my job. I sincerely enjoy talking to my coworkers about their lives. I also enjoy talking to students and assisting them with whatever they need.
- What advice would you give to a CSU student? My advice would be to keep a close watch on your emails. We send you important deadlines and updates via email.
